What is day trading?
Day trading is a short-term trading strategy that involves buying and selling financial assets, such as cryptocurrencies, within the same day. Traders who engage in day trading aim to take advantage of small price fluctuations in order to make quick profits. This strategy requires active monitoring of the market and making rapid buying and selling decisions. Day trading can be highly rewarding but also carries significant risks, as the volatile nature of cryptocurrencies can lead to substantial losses if not managed properly.

Support and resistance levels
Support and resistance levels play a crucial role in day trading crypto. These levels are key areas on a chart where the price of a cryptocurrency tends to find support as it falls or resistance as it rises. Traders use support and resistance levels to make informed decisions about when to buy or sell a cryptocurrency. By identifying these levels, traders can set stop-loss orders to limit potential losses and take-profit orders to secure profits. Additionally, support and resistance levels can also indicate potential breakouts or reversals in the price of a cryptocurrency, providing valuable opportunities for traders to capitalize on market movements.
Indicators and oscillators
Indicators and oscillators play a crucial role in day trading crypto. These tools help traders analyze market trends and identify potential entry and exit points. Commonly used indicators include moving averages, relative strength index (RSI), and stochastic oscillators. Moving averages provide insight into the average price of an asset over a specific period, while RSI and stochastic oscillators indicate overbought or oversold conditions. By understanding and utilizing these indicators and oscillators, day traders can make informed decisions and increase their chances of success in the volatile crypto market.

Setting stop-loss orders
Setting stop-loss orders is a crucial aspect of day trading crypto. It involves placing an order to sell a cryptocurrency when its price reaches a certain level, in order to limit potential losses. By setting a stop-loss order, traders can protect their investments and minimize the impact of sudden price drops. This risk management strategy is essential for traders who want to mitigate the volatility and uncertainty of the cryptocurrency market. Implementing stop-loss orders allows traders to maintain control over their trades and make informed decisions based on their risk tolerance and trading strategies.

Swing trading
Swing trading is a popular strategy used by many cryptocurrency traders. Unlike day trading, which involves buying and selling assets within a single day, swing trading involves holding onto assets for a longer period of time, typically a few days to a few weeks. The goal of swing trading is to capture short-term price movements and profit from market fluctuations. Traders who engage in swing trading analyze technical indicators and chart patterns to identify potential entry and exit points. This strategy requires patience and discipline, as traders need to wait for the right opportunities to buy or sell. Swing trading can be a profitable approach for those who are able to accurately predict short-term price movements and effectively manage their risk.
